#### retryOperation.reset()

Resets the internal state of the operation object, so that you can call `attempt()` again as if this was a new operation object.
Resets the internal state of the operation object. You can then call `retry()` (passing an error not required), and the entire operation will begin again as if it's the first attempt.

```
var operation = retry.operation();
operation.attempt(function(currentAttempt) {
var err;
try{
doSomething();
}
catch(e){
e = err;
}

if (needToStartFromScratch()){
operation.reset();
operation.retry();
return;
}

if (operation.retry(err)) return;
});
```
